Codex Raises Auto-Compaction Baseline and Long Context Tips

soumitrashukla9 · x · 2026-07-12

OpenAI Codex has increased its auto-compaction baseline from roughly 262K to 353K. Although GPT-5.6 currently supports a 1M context window, lengthy browser/computer automation tasks introduce massive amounts of useless accessibility tree markup. This can distract the model, worsen compaction loss, and impact accuracy.

The author suggests that for token-intensive automation tasks, you can configure modelautocompacttokenlimit=900000 to individually raise the compaction threshold for specific project folders, balancing performance and cost.
